CSS [attribute ^ = value]选择器

  • 定义和用法

    [attribute ^ = value]选择器匹配属性值以指定值开头的每个元素。
    特征 说明
    CSS版本 CSS3
  • 浏览器支持

    表中的数字指定了完全支持该属性的第一个浏览器版本。数字后跟-ms-, -webkit-,-moz-或-o-指定使用前缀的第一个版本。
    选择器 IE/Edge Chrome FireFox Safari Opera
    选择器名称
    [attribute ^ = value]
    7.0
    4.0
    3.5
    3.2
    9.6
    注意:要使[attribute ^ = value]在IE8及更早版本中工作,必须声明<!DOCTYPE>
  • CSS语法

    attribute ^= value {
      css declarations;
    }
  • 实例

    在所有具有以“test”开头的class属性值的<div>元素上设置背景颜色:
    div[class^="test"] {
      background: #ffff00;
    }
    
    尝试一下